Subject: Catalogue import cut-over — done

Hi Verena,

Cut-over to the new Lindqvist catalogue importer completed last night. Legacy feed disabled at 02:10; new pipeline picked up the full backlog by 04:40. Record counts reconciled — 412k titles, zero orphaned holdings. Dedupe pass flagged 37 items; queued for manual review by the cataloguing team.

Rollback window closes Friday. No incidents so far.

For the release notes, the importer now runs with these settings.

service settings:
[silwyn]
host = silwyn.crelvogrid.internal
user = silwyn_svc
database = silwyn_prod

Finance team: planning for the retirement of the Lanthorn instrument series should be reflected in Q2 forecasts onward. Expect a one-time inventory write-down, provisionally estimated between four and six percent of carried stock value, plus residual warranty reserves running eighteen months post-sunset. Supplier commitments with the Ferelane foundry terminate at quarter-end with modest break fees. Please model both the accelerated and staged clearance scenarios for the review. The confidential plan summary follows below.

board note of kagep-yahig: Only 9 of the 120 pilot accounts renewed Quenix, so a churn review is set for April 1.

Handover: SDK parity, Wrenfield project. The Kestrel (Go) SDK now supports streaming uploads, retry budgets, and typed errors; the Marlet (Python) SDK lags on all three. Parity matrix lives in docs/parity.md — keep it current per release. Open gaps: chunked transfer in Marlet is half-done on branch parity-chunks; tests pass locally only. Do not cut a Marlet release until the matrix shows green on uploads. Review each parity PR against the matrix. Ongoing parity work is owned by the person below.

named custodian: Belius Casath Ulaix Sorius

## Authentication

Heads up: the nightly reindex job (`reindex_nightly.py`) talks to the Lanternfish search cluster, and that cluster won't accept anonymous writes anymore — we locked it down last sprint. The job now authenticates as the `reindex-runner` service identity against Corvid Gateway, and the token is injected via the `LF_INDEX_TOKEN` env var in the scheduler config. Nothing clever going on, just a bearer header on every batch request. For review purposes, the staging credential currently in use is listed below.

service key, kadug-kadup: kto15_rN23XLAYImmZgrJ